Cargando…

A Novel Focal Phi Loss for Power Line Segmentation with Auxiliary Classifier U-Net

The segmentation of power lines (PLs) from aerial images is a crucial task for the safe navigation of unmanned aerial vehicles (UAVs) operating at low altitudes. Despite the advances in deep learning-based approaches for PL segmentation, these models are still vulnerable to the class imbalance prese...

Descripción completa

Detalles Bibliográficos
Autores principales: Jaffari, Rabeea, Hashmani, Manzoor Ahmed, Reyes-Aldasoro, Constantino Carlos
Formato: Online Artículo Texto
Lenguaje:English
Publicado: MDPI 2021
Materias:
Acceso en línea:https://www.ncbi.nlm.nih.gov/pmc/articles/PMC8073893/
https://www.ncbi.nlm.nih.gov/pubmed/33923472
http://dx.doi.org/10.3390/s21082803
_version_ 1783684234457645056
author Jaffari, Rabeea
Hashmani, Manzoor Ahmed
Reyes-Aldasoro, Constantino Carlos
author_facet Jaffari, Rabeea
Hashmani, Manzoor Ahmed
Reyes-Aldasoro, Constantino Carlos
author_sort Jaffari, Rabeea
collection PubMed
description The segmentation of power lines (PLs) from aerial images is a crucial task for the safe navigation of unmanned aerial vehicles (UAVs) operating at low altitudes. Despite the advances in deep learning-based approaches for PL segmentation, these models are still vulnerable to the class imbalance present in the data. The PLs occupy only a minimal portion (1–5%) of the aerial images as compared to the background region (95–99%). Generally, this class imbalance problem is addressed via the use of PL-specific detectors in conjunction with the popular class balanced cross entropy (BBCE) loss function. However, these PL-specific detectors do not work outside their application areas and a BBCE loss requires hyperparameter tuning for class-wise weights, which is not trivial. Moreover, the BBCE loss results in low dice scores and precision values and thus, fails to achieve an optimal trade-off between dice scores, model accuracy, and precision–recall values. In this work, we propose a generalized focal loss function based on the Matthews correlation coefficient (MCC) or the Phi coefficient to address the class imbalance problem in PL segmentation while utilizing a generic deep segmentation architecture. We evaluate our loss function by improving the vanilla U-Net model with an additional convolutional auxiliary classifier head (ACU-Net) for better learning and faster model convergence. The evaluation of two PL datasets, namely the Mendeley Power Line Dataset and the Power Line Dataset of Urban Scenes (PLDU), where PLs occupy around 1% and 2% of the aerial images area, respectively, reveal that our proposed loss function outperforms the popular BBCE loss by 16% in PL dice scores on both the datasets, 19% in precision and false detection rate (FDR) values for the Mendeley PL dataset and 15% in precision and FDR values for the PLDU with a minor degradation in the accuracy and recall values. Moreover, our proposed ACU-Net outperforms the baseline vanilla U-Net for the characteristic evaluation parameters in the range of 1–10% for both the PL datasets. Thus, our proposed loss function with ACU-Net achieves an optimal trade-off for the characteristic evaluation parameters without any bells and whistles. Our code is available at Github.
format Online
Article
Text
id pubmed-8073893
institution National Center for Biotechnology Information
language English
publishDate 2021
publisher MDPI
record_format MEDLINE/PubMed
spelling pubmed-80738932021-04-27 A Novel Focal Phi Loss for Power Line Segmentation with Auxiliary Classifier U-Net Jaffari, Rabeea Hashmani, Manzoor Ahmed Reyes-Aldasoro, Constantino Carlos Sensors (Basel) Article The segmentation of power lines (PLs) from aerial images is a crucial task for the safe navigation of unmanned aerial vehicles (UAVs) operating at low altitudes. Despite the advances in deep learning-based approaches for PL segmentation, these models are still vulnerable to the class imbalance present in the data. The PLs occupy only a minimal portion (1–5%) of the aerial images as compared to the background region (95–99%). Generally, this class imbalance problem is addressed via the use of PL-specific detectors in conjunction with the popular class balanced cross entropy (BBCE) loss function. However, these PL-specific detectors do not work outside their application areas and a BBCE loss requires hyperparameter tuning for class-wise weights, which is not trivial. Moreover, the BBCE loss results in low dice scores and precision values and thus, fails to achieve an optimal trade-off between dice scores, model accuracy, and precision–recall values. In this work, we propose a generalized focal loss function based on the Matthews correlation coefficient (MCC) or the Phi coefficient to address the class imbalance problem in PL segmentation while utilizing a generic deep segmentation architecture. We evaluate our loss function by improving the vanilla U-Net model with an additional convolutional auxiliary classifier head (ACU-Net) for better learning and faster model convergence. The evaluation of two PL datasets, namely the Mendeley Power Line Dataset and the Power Line Dataset of Urban Scenes (PLDU), where PLs occupy around 1% and 2% of the aerial images area, respectively, reveal that our proposed loss function outperforms the popular BBCE loss by 16% in PL dice scores on both the datasets, 19% in precision and false detection rate (FDR) values for the Mendeley PL dataset and 15% in precision and FDR values for the PLDU with a minor degradation in the accuracy and recall values. Moreover, our proposed ACU-Net outperforms the baseline vanilla U-Net for the characteristic evaluation parameters in the range of 1–10% for both the PL datasets. Thus, our proposed loss function with ACU-Net achieves an optimal trade-off for the characteristic evaluation parameters without any bells and whistles. Our code is available at Github. MDPI 2021-04-16 /pmc/articles/PMC8073893/ /pubmed/33923472 http://dx.doi.org/10.3390/s21082803 Text en © 2021 by the authors. https://creativecommons.org/licenses/by/4.0/Licensee MDPI, Basel, Switzerland. This article is an open access article distributed under the terms and conditions of the Creative Commons Attribution (CC BY) license (https://creativecommons.org/licenses/by/4.0/).
spellingShingle Article
Jaffari, Rabeea
Hashmani, Manzoor Ahmed
Reyes-Aldasoro, Constantino Carlos
A Novel Focal Phi Loss for Power Line Segmentation with Auxiliary Classifier U-Net
title A Novel Focal Phi Loss for Power Line Segmentation with Auxiliary Classifier U-Net
title_full A Novel Focal Phi Loss for Power Line Segmentation with Auxiliary Classifier U-Net
title_fullStr A Novel Focal Phi Loss for Power Line Segmentation with Auxiliary Classifier U-Net
title_full_unstemmed A Novel Focal Phi Loss for Power Line Segmentation with Auxiliary Classifier U-Net
title_short A Novel Focal Phi Loss for Power Line Segmentation with Auxiliary Classifier U-Net
title_sort novel focal phi loss for power line segmentation with auxiliary classifier u-net
topic Article
url https://www.ncbi.nlm.nih.gov/pmc/articles/PMC8073893/
https://www.ncbi.nlm.nih.gov/pubmed/33923472
http://dx.doi.org/10.3390/s21082803
work_keys_str_mv AT jaffarirabeea anovelfocalphilossforpowerlinesegmentationwithauxiliaryclassifierunet
AT hashmanimanzoorahmed anovelfocalphilossforpowerlinesegmentationwithauxiliaryclassifierunet
AT reyesaldasoroconstantinocarlos anovelfocalphilossforpowerlinesegmentationwithauxiliaryclassifierunet
AT jaffarirabeea novelfocalphilossforpowerlinesegmentationwithauxiliaryclassifierunet
AT hashmanimanzoorahmed novelfocalphilossforpowerlinesegmentationwithauxiliaryclassifierunet
AT reyesaldasoroconstantinocarlos novelfocalphilossforpowerlinesegmentationwithauxiliaryclassifierunet